Why These Are the Top Mazda Repair Auto Repair Shops in Fairview

The Mazda repair market for residents of Fairview, WV, is almost entirely dependent on the larger market in Morgantown. The level of specialization is moderate; while there are no dedicated Mazda-only performance shops, several reputable independent garages have developed strong sub-specialties to meet local demand. The competition is healthy but not saturated, leading to fair pricing. For standard maintenance (oil changes, brakes) on a modern Mazda, labor rates typically range from **$95 - $120/hour**. Specialized diagnostics or performance work can command rates of **$130 - $150/hour**. For highly complex issues, particularly with the Mazda Connect system or advanced drivetrain components, some owners still opt for the dealership experience, which requires a longer drive to areas like Bridgeport or Pittsburgh, at a significantly higher cost. What are the most common Mazda repair issues you see in Fairview, WV, and are they affected by our local driving conditions?

In Fairview, we commonly address issues with Mazda's Skyactiv engine carbon buildup, worn suspension components from our rural and sometimes uneven roads, and brake corrosion accelerated by winter road treatments. Seasonal temperature swings can also stress electrical components and batteries.

Are repair costs for Mazdas generally higher in Fairview compared to larger cities, and what's a fair price range for common services?

Labor rates in Fairview can be more competitive than in major metro areas, though part costs are similar. For common services, expect a price range of $80-$150 for an oil change/filter on a Skyactiv engine and $300-$600 for a typical brake job, but always get a detailed estimate upfront.

What local considerations should Fairview Mazda owners keep in mind for preventative maintenance?

Given our hilly terrain and use of road salt in winter, prioritize regular undercarriage inspections for rust and more frequent brake checks. Also, ensure your cooling system is serviced to handle summer heat and that your cabin air filter is changed regularly to manage pollen and dust from rural roads.
